Job Description

The Centre of Excellence in Women and Child Health aims to support the introduction, scale-up and further piloting of high quality and high impact interventions to improve Maternal, Newborn, Child and Adolescent Health (MNCAH) in Pakistan by harnessing the potential of both public and private sectors, coupled with introduction of women and girls empowerment intervention.
The Data Management Unit is responsible for providing data management and computing support to the wide range of community and clinical research projects throughout the department. The unit has longstanding experience in data management of various research projects. The core areas of activity include designing and archiving Case Report Files, data entry and management programming, data analysis, GIS mapping, IT and computing support.

Responsibilities:
You will be responsible to analyze and interpret data from research projects, prepare descriptive tables, check the data for inaccuracies', data cleaning and management, and report results of statistical analysis. Specific responsibilities include to:
analyze and interpret data from research projects and prepare descriptive tables
check data for inaccuracies, data cleaning and management
report results of statistical analysis including information in the form of graphs, charts and tables
responsible for data processing for accurate relocation, formatting, generating and transmitting required data
responsible for making statistical model selections, experimental design, design and analysis of clinical trials
prepare statistical contribution to Integrated Study Report
develop project analysis plan, including computer generated table specifications, statistical analysis plan and research report format
use statistical techniques and models to forecast results, trends and needs

Requirements:
You should have:
a Masters degree in Statistics, Data Sciences or equivalent
at least two years of relevant experience, preferably in public health or a research organization
excellent command on SPSS, STATA and other statistical packages
proficient in spreadsheets and Microsoft Office
sound knowledge of data base management and computer programming
strong verbal and written communication skills
